The cheapest times to fly from Rome to Buenos Aires

On average, Thursday can be the cheapest time to fly, according to data from the Airlines Reporting Corporation (ARC), one of the world's biggest databases for global airline sales. The data reveals that you could save up to 16% by flying on a Thursday—the cheapest day to travel on average—instead of a Sunday—the most expensive. Some of the most affordable flights from Rome to Buenos Aires are during the month of January. The best time to book a flight from Rome to Buenos Aires

Sunday is one of the best days to book for cheap flights from Rome to Buenos Aires: Tickets reserved on a Sunday cost between 6% and 13% less than those reserved on a Friday, according to ARC data. The data also suggests booking early can also lead to cheaper airfares. You could save 24% by buying your tickets for domestic flights at least a month in advance and 10% by booking international flights 2 months in advance.

How many flights per day from Fiumicino - Leonardo da Vinci Intl. Airport (FCO) to Ministro Pistarini Intl. Airport (EZE)?
On average, Fiumicino - Leonardo da Vinci Intl. Airport (FCO) only has 1 direct flight to Ministro Pistarini Intl. Airport (EZE) every day. For more options, try our easy-to-use filters. Just enter your travel dates, then choose "1 Stop" or "2+ Stops" to discover flights offering layovers.
What are the most popular departure times for flights from Fiumicino - Leonardo da Vinci Intl. Airport (FCO) to Ministro Pistarini Intl. Airport (EZE)?
Flights between FCO and EZE are their busiest at 10 PM. If you'd like a less crowded experience and possibly cheaper tickets, choose a time outside the usual busy windows.
What day of the week has the most flights from FCO to EZE?
Depart on a Friday if you're searching for the biggest selection of flights from Fiumicino - Leonardo da Vinci Intl. Airport (FCO) to Ministro Pistarini Intl. Airport (EZE).
What is the earliest flight from Fiumicino - Leonardo da Vinci Intl. Airport (FCO) to Ministro Pistarini Intl. Airport (EZE)?
The earliest flight leaving Fiumicino - Leonardo da Vinci Intl. Airport (FCO) is at around 9:45AM UTC+1. Board this plane and you'll arrive at Ministro Pistarini Intl. Airport (EZE) at approximately 7:50PM UTC-3. The entire trip takes 14h 5m.
How long does it take to fly from Fiumicino - Leonardo da Vinci Intl. Airport (FCO) to Ministro Pistarini Intl. Airport (EZE)?
The average flight duration from FCO to EZE is 14 hours and 9 minutes, covering a total distance of 6,900 mi.
What airline has the least delays from FCO to EZE?
With 93% of flights usually arriving as scheduled, Aerolineas Argentinas has the best on-time performance for direct flights from Fiumicino - Leonardo da Vinci Intl. Airport (FCO) to Ministro Pistarini Intl. Airport (EZE). To monitor your flight status and get notifications if anything changes, use the Expedia App.
What is the best time to fly from Fiumicino - Leonardo da Vinci Intl. Airport (FCO) to Ministro Pistarini Intl. Airport (EZE)?
Opt for a flight from Fiumicino - Leonardo da Vinci Intl. Airport (FCO) to Ministro Pistarini Intl. Airport (EZE) that leaves before 3 PM to reduce the risk of delays and cancellations. Departures later than this have a 22% higher chance of being canceled, on average.**Most reliable time of the day and month to travel recommendation is based on January through August 2024 flight status data sourced from OAG's global flight data platform.
What airports do you fly into for Buenos Aires from Fiumicino - Leonardo da Vinci Intl. Airport (FCO)?
If you're traveling on a direct flight from Fiumicino - Leonardo da Vinci Intl. Airport (FCO) to Buenos Aires, Ministro Pistarini Intl. Airport (EZE) is the only airport you can land at.
